U.S. Advisory Commission on Public Diplomacy; Notice of Meeting

    The U.S. Advisory Commission on Public Diplomacy will hold a public 
meeting from 10:00 a.m. until 12:00 p.m., Wednesday, September 4, 2019, 
at the Elliott School of International Affairs at George Washington 
University in the Lindner Family Commons, Room 602 (1957 E Street NW, 
Washington, DC 20052). The focus of the meeting will be the creation of 
the new Global Public Affairs Bureau and the accompanying strategic 
vision for Public Diplomacy going forward in the Department of State.

    The U.S. Advisory Commission on Public Diplomacy appraises U.S. 
government activities intended to understand, inform, and influence 
foreign publics. The Advisory Commission may conduct studies, 
inquiries, and meetings, as it deems necessary. It may assemble and 
disseminate information and issue reports and other publications, 
subject to the approval of the Chairperson, in consultation with the 
Executive Director. The Advisory Commission may undertake foreign 
travel in pursuit of its studies and coordinate, sponsor, or oversee 
projects, studies, events, or other activities that it deems desirable 
and necessary in fulfilling its functions.
